Analyzing Paddy Pimblett's Fighting Style and Skillset

Paddy Pimblett's fighting style is characterized by aggressive pressure, a potent blend of striking and grappling, and an unwavering determination. He possesses an excellent ground game, evidenced by his impressive submission skills, often securing early finishes.

  • Strengths and weaknesses: His striking, while improving, is still an area that requires refinement at the highest level. His tendency to engage in brawls can leave him open to counterattacks. While his cardio has improved noticeably, maintaining peak performance over a five-round championship bout is still a question mark.
  • Potential for improvement: To reach championship caliber, Pimblett needs to hone his defensive striking, diversify his offense to avoid becoming predictable, and ensure consistent stamina management across longer fights.
